A 160-year engineering house behind the plotted format

Founded in 1865, Shapoorji Pallonji Group started as a partnership firm that forayed into the construction industry with infrastructure projects, including pavement and water reservoir construction in Mumbai. The company is based at BKC in Mumbai and works across real estate, construction, energy, water and infrastructure, and is today led by Shapoor Mistry and Pallon S. Mistry. On the real estate side, Shapoorji Pallonji Real Estate (SPRE) was the first Indian company to construct two 60-storey residential towers in Mumbai, and the wider group's engineering credentials extend abroad, having built the famous Royal Palace for the Sultan of Oman. SPRE has made inroads into most major Indian cities — the Mumbai Metropolitan Region, Pune, Bengaluru, Gurugram, Howrah and Kolkata — with developments ranging from luxury apartments to aspirational homes for mid-income buyers and some of the largest mass housing projects in India. It is this scale and balance-sheet depth that the group is now extending into low-density plotted formats such as Delphi Khopoli, alongside towers and townships closer to Mumbai and Pune.

Why Khalapur-Khopoli sits on SPRE's growth map

Khopoli is an industrial city in the Khalapur taluka of Raigad district, at the base of the Sahyadri mountains, and part of the Mumbai Metropolitan Region. Delphi Khopoli is positioned in the foothills of Khopoli, between Mumbai and Pune, benefiting from direct expressway connectivity while offering a cooler climate and scenic mountain surroundings. The town's relevance to the region has just been reinforced by a major road upgrade: the Mumbai-Pune Expressway's long-delayed Missing Link, a 13.3 km eight-lane realignment with twin tunnels and a cable-stayed bridge, starts at Khopoli on the Mumbai side and ends at Kusgaon near Lonavala, and opened on 1 May 2026, coinciding with Maharashtra Day, cutting roughly half an hour off the ghat-section drive between the two cities. That single infrastructure event changes how a plotted address at Khopoli's edge relates to both Mumbai and Pune.

Industrial and employment base

Khalapur-Khopoli is not a speculative dormitory town; it has a working industrial economy. The area connects to major industrial hubs and ports including JNPT and the upcoming Navi Mumbai International Airport, and is surrounded by industrial zones such as Taloja and Khalapur. Major industries in and around Khopoli, including the Khopoli Freehold Industrial Area and Khalapur MIDC, span pharmaceuticals, engineering, food processing, packaging and chemicals, with large firms such as Parle International and L&T located nearby. This employment base is a structural demand driver for housing and land in the belt, distinct from purely tourism-led second-home markets elsewhere in the Sahyadri foothills.

Connectivity and social infrastructure

Khopoli is served by a railway station connected to the Mumbai suburban railway by a single line from Karjat, in addition to expressway access. Imagica Theme Park and nearby waterfalls are key attractions, and Khopoli sits close to tourist destinations like Khandala and Lonavala. Schooling and healthcare in the town are modest but present, with various institutions running schools, colleges and a polytechnic locally.

Price context in the belt

Land and housing values in Khopoli remain well below Mumbai or Navi Mumbai benchmarks, which is part of the corridor's appeal. The average price of a plot in Khopoli can range from about ₹1,500 to ₹4,500 per sq ft, depending on the type of plot, amenities and location, while the average flat rate in the town is around ₹4,200 per sq ft. These are area-wide figures across multiple developers and plot categories, not a quote for any specific SPRE inventory.
